Searched refs:RubyRequestType (Results 1 - 18 of 18) sorted by relevance
/gem5/src/mem/ruby/system/ |
H A D | CacheRecorder.hh | 44 #include "mem/ruby/protocol/RubyRequestType.hh" 60 RubyRequestType m_type; 77 RubyRequestType type, Tick time, DataBlock& data);
|
H A D | GPUCoalescer.hh | 50 #include "mem/ruby/protocol/RubyRequestType.hh" 67 RubyRequestType m_type; 70 GPUCoalescerRequest(PacketPtr _pkt, RubyRequestType _m_type, 79 RequestDesc(PacketPtr pkt, RubyRequestType p_type, RubyRequestType s_type) 90 RubyRequestType primaryType; 91 RubyRequestType secondaryType; 226 bool tryCacheAccess(Addr addr, RubyRequestType type, 230 virtual void issueRequest(PacketPtr pkt, RubyRequestType type); 253 RubyRequestType request_typ [all...] |
H A D | Sequencer.hh | 37 #include "mem/ruby/protocol/RubyRequestType.hh" 46 RubyRequestType m_type; 49 SequencerRequest(PacketPtr _pkt, RubyRequestType _m_type, 152 void issueRequest(PacketPtr pkt, RubyRequestType type); 161 void recordMissLatency(const Cycles t, const RubyRequestType type, 168 RequestStatus insertRequest(PacketPtr pkt, RubyRequestType request_type);
|
H A D | VIPERCoalescer.cc | 216 RubyRequestType request_type = RubyRequestType_REPLACEMENT; 247 RubyRequestType request_type = RubyRequestType_FLUSH; 275 RubyRequestType request_type = RubyRequestType_REPLACEMENT; 291 RubyRequestType request_type = RubyRequestType_FLUSH;
|
H A D | Sequencer.cc | 162 Sequencer::insertRequest(PacketPtr pkt, RubyRequestType request_type) 310 Sequencer::recordMissLatency(const Cycles cycles, const RubyRequestType type, 449 RubyRequestType type = srequest->m_type; 536 RubyRequestType primary_type = RubyRequestType_NULL; 537 RubyRequestType secondary_type = RubyRequestType_NULL; 620 Sequencer::issueRequest(PacketPtr pkt, RubyRequestType secondary_type)
|
H A D | GPUCoalescer.cc | 235 GPUCoalescer::getRequestStatus(PacketPtr pkt, RubyRequestType request_type) 312 GPUCoalescer::insertRequest(PacketPtr pkt, RubyRequestType request_type) 607 RubyRequestType type = srequest->m_type; 731 RubyRequestType primary_type = RubyRequestType_NULL; 732 RubyRequestType secondary_type = RubyRequestType_NULL; 872 GPUCoalescer::issueRequest(PacketPtr pkt, RubyRequestType secondary_type) 1187 RubyRequestType type = srequest->m_type;
|
H A D | CacheRecorder.cc | 153 RubyRequestType type, Tick time, DataBlock& data)
|
/gem5/src/mem/ruby/slicc_interface/ |
H A D | RubyRequest.hh | 43 #include "mem/ruby/protocol/RubyRequestType.hh" 50 RubyRequestType m_Type; 66 uint64_t _pc, RubyRequestType _type, RubyAccessMode _access_mode, 88 uint64_t _pc, RubyRequestType _type, 115 uint64_t _pc, RubyRequestType _type, 149 const RubyRequestType& getType() const { return m_Type; }
|
H A D | AbstractController.hh | 109 virtual Cycles mandatoryQueueLatency(const RubyRequestType& param_type) 123 virtual void enqueuePrefetch(const Addr &, const RubyRequestType&) argument
|
/gem5/src/mem/ruby/structures/ |
H A D | Prefetcher.hh | 73 RubyRequestType m_type; 103 void observeMiss(Addr address, const RubyRequestType& type); 127 uint32_t index, const RubyRequestType& type);
|
H A D | CacheMemory.hh | 61 bool tryCacheAccess(Addr address, RubyRequestType type, 65 bool testCacheAccess(Addr address, RubyRequestType type,
|
H A D | Prefetcher.cc | 139 Prefetcher::observeMiss(Addr address, const RubyRequestType& type) 289 uint32_t index, const RubyRequestType& type)
|
H A D | CacheMemory.cc | 163 CacheMemory::tryCacheAccess(Addr address, RubyRequestType type, 190 CacheMemory::testCacheAccess(Addr address, RubyRequestType type, 404 RubyRequestType request_type = RubyRequestType_NULL;
|
/gem5/src/mem/ruby/profiler/ |
H A D | AccessTraceForAddress.cc | 62 AccessTraceForAddress::update(RubyRequestType type,
|
H A D | AccessTraceForAddress.hh | 37 #include "mem/ruby/protocol/RubyRequestType.hh" 51 void update(RubyRequestType type, RubyAccessMode access_mode, NodeID cpu,
|
H A D | Profiler.cc | 176 RubyRequestType(i))) 184 RubyRequestType(i))) 192 RubyRequestType(i))) 200 RubyRequestType(i))) 208 RubyRequestType(i))) 324 RubyRequestType(i), MachineType(j))) 332 RubyRequestType(i), MachineType(j))) 340 RubyRequestType(i), MachineType(j)))
|
H A D | AddressProfiler.hh | 57 RubyRequestType type, RubyAccessMode access_mode,
|
H A D | AddressProfiler.cc | 284 RubyRequestType type,
|
Completed in 60 milliseconds